BMW Philippines offers wide customization options on new M models

GOOD THINGS come to those who wait. And that’s exactly the message SMC Asia Car Distributors Corp. (SM ACDC), the official importer and distributor of BMW vehicles in the Philippines, wants to deliver to fans of the Munich-based car maker.

Its trio of M vehicles — the all-new M3 Competition Sedan, all-new M4 Competition Coupé, and refreshed M5 Competition — can be customized to the customer’s druthers from “various M parts and ex-factory price options to lend their M vehicle a special touch with the highest standards of quality.”

In a release, SMC ACDC President Spencer Yu said, “It’s all about making our finest cars even more special. Our customers value and deserve exclusivity and individuality; and that is exactly what our BMW M division caters to. The selection process allows for limitless combinations between exterior, interior, and performance features to make the overall experience of buying and owning a BMW M car genuinely exciting.”

The wait will take four to six months, but BMW buyers will surely delight in the bespoke quality of their vehicles once these get to them.

For buyers of the BMW M5 Competition, exclusive interior finishes are available such as BMW Individual fine-wood trims, stand-alone options like a Bowers and Wilkins surround sound system, BMW Individual paint colors, and a range of M light alloy wheels.

On the other hand, the all-new BMW M3 Competition Sedan and all-new BMW M4 Competition Coupé are offered in “a thrilling set of materials to choose from.” Customers can opt for unique body paintwork and distinct colors for interior panels. The customization even extends to the complement of driver assistance systems, such as the BMW head-up display and Parking Assistant Plus, or high-performance accessories like M carbon ceramic brakes. “BMW guarantees that customers are free to handpick the details,” insisted the company.

Globally launched last year, the all-new BMW M3 Competition Sedan and BMW M4 Competition Coupé are siblings with a long history — it’s been 35 years since the original M3 rolled out. These midsized high-performance sports cars in sedan and coupé iteration are said to be “track-optimized” while nonetheless boasting everyday utility.

Both are powered by a high-revving in-line six-cylinder engine returning 510hp, mated to an eight-speed M Steptronic transmission with Drivelogic. “The new 3.0-liter straight-six unit combines the hallmark high-revving character of BMW M GmbH engines with the latest version of M TwinPower Turbo technology. Two turbochargers with indirect charge air cooling, a flow-optimized air intake system, and a petrol direct injection system working with maximum pressure of 350 bar help to generate the engine’s instantaneous power delivery and appetite for revs, which it sustains without interruption into the higher reaches of the engine speed range,” said BMW.

Meanwhile, the BMW 5 M Competition is distinguished from its normal 5 siblings through black styling details. A high-gloss black finish marks the BMW kidney grille surround, mesh on the M gills, the exterior mirror caps and additional rear spoiler on the boot. The rear apron gets black inserts. M5 Competition logos are on the kidney grille, gills and boot lid, while the door sill plates have an illuminated version. The tailpipes of the standard M Sport exhaust system are finished in black chrome.

Under the hood is BMW’s S63 V8 engine promising 625hp at 6,000rpm. At 1,850rpm, the peak torque of 750Nm arrives and “is sustained at this elevated level all the way to 5,860rpm.” The new BMW M5 Competition reaches 100kph from standstill in only 3.3 seconds; 200kph from rest in 10.8 seconds. It can muster a top speed of 250kph.

The kind of bespoke options afforded the M line will be unrivaled in the BMW stable. In response to a question from “Velocity,” Spencer Yu said, “We will be keeping the customization options exclusive to our M models. Giving our customers an opportunity to personalize their vehicles simply makes the purchasing experience ultimately more enjoyable. We hope that this brings not only automobile enthusiasts but also aspiring performance car owners closer to the world of BMW M.”
